What is Dublin Bus & DART Times?
Dublin Bus & DART Times is a real-time public transport app for Dublin and the Republic of Ireland. It provides live bus, train, and tram times, plus trip planning and service alerts.

Does it work with Dublin Bus?
Yes — it includes all Dublin Bus and Go-Ahead Ireland routes with live arrival times and stop information.

Does it include DART and Irish Rail?
Absolutely. You can view live DART departures, InterCity train timetables, and Irish Rail service alerts.

Does it support the Luas?
Yes — both the Green and Red Luas lines are included, with live tram tracking and service updates.

Can I check nationwide routes?
Yes — the app includes Bus Éireann, Expressway, Local Link, and other regional services across Ireland.

Can I use Dublin Bus & DART Times offline?
Yes — offline maps and saved timetables let you plan ahead without mobile data.

Will it tell me when to get off?
Yes. “Get Off Alerts” use GPS to notify you just before your stop.

Is Dublin Bus & DART Times free?
Yes — it’s free to download and use, with optional premium features and widgets available via in-app purchase.

### 2026.7.5 — 2026-05-23

To celebrate World Awareness Day this month, we've added an extra accessibility feature - custom fonts. From the Settings screen, you can now choose from several easy-to-read fonts that will be used throughout the app, including dyslexic-friendly typefaces.

New: Destination Filters

Just open up a station board, tap on Destination and choose the station you want to get to. You'll only see the services that stop there. Great for busy stations where you want to cut out the noise and focus on the lines that you care about.

Best of all, it works for bus stops as well: tap on Destination and choose the place you're going to, and we'll work out which bus lines from that stop go there.

Previously...

Saved Stops by Distance
Now just tap the toggle on the Saved tab to re-order your saved stops and stations by how close they are to you.

Service Alert Summaries
No more scrolling through long lists of alerts. The app now creates a short summary highlighting the most recent and important disruptions affecting your journey.

Better for your battery
We’ve made major optimisations to how the app uses location and background activity while you’re travelling. You can now tap GO with confidence that it won’t drain your battery.

Smarter Live Activities
Live Activities now end cleanly when you reach your destination. You’ll also see a quick summary of your trip when a Live Activity begins.

Home & Work improvements
You can now edit or remove your Home and Work locations again. Saved places and stations also sync automatically through iCloud, keeping all your devices up to date.

Powerful new Shortcuts support
You can now start live directions directly from Shortcuts or Siri. Instead of opening the app, directions begin instantly as a Live Activity - perfect for routines like starting your commute each morning.

The app also remembers your preferred routes. If a familiar journey is available, it will be selected automatically. Otherwise, just choose a route once and we’ll remember it for next time.

Clearer train departure boards
Train times are now easier to read in both the app and widgets, so you can find what you need at a glance.
